r - 在命令行的报告中包含来自 R markdown 代码块的输出
问题描述
我在 Linux 命令行中使用 R,因为我不想安装 R Studio。我想生成一个 pdf 报告,其中包含我的所有代码以及以可读格式作为数字和 LaTeX 向量的代码输出。
我安装了 knitr 和 markdown 使用install.packages('package')
我使用导入library('library')
我正在尝试使用rmarkdown::render('path',pdf_document)
我的代码块以 ``{r} 开头,但是当我生成报告并显示 pdf 时,它不包括我的代码的任何输出,只有块。
解决方案
为了生成带有结果的报告,自述文件上的文件扩展名必须是“.Rmd”而不是“.Rscript”或“.R”
推荐阅读
- c# - (C# Forms) 刽子手游戏“argumentoutofrange”
- c# - System.Web 将 C# 项目从 AnyCPU 切换到 x64 时生成错误
- spring-data-jpa - 在 Spring Data JPA 中使用动态列和 where 子句创建查询,在 QueryDSL 中是否可以?
- c++ - 如何创建一个像标准库头一样的头,这样程序就可以在不链接头中函数的所有目标文件的情况下进行编译?
- rust - 如何从 crate/module/functions 派生代码?
- php - SQL DISTINCT 选择不适用于不等于
- jmeter - Jmeter 如何避免调用相同的 HTTP Req。针对不同的条件
- ios - 键入时在文本字段中格式化电话号码
- linux - 是否可以对文件夹应用计数功能,然后在文件夹超过限制时删除文件?
- android - 如何在 C# 中将 Android.Net.Uri 转换为字节数组